## Step 4: Migrate locker access flow

Tumblebay's laundry lockers move from PIN-only to app-token access in this step. Customers on the old flow keep working until the cutover date; after that, PINs are rejected and support should walk them through the Tumblebay app pairing. Do not re-issue PINs during the transition — it resets the locker's token table and strands the queue. Escalate stuck lockers to the Fernmoor hardware team. Apply the settings shown below to each migrated site.

config for tagep-yajef:
ulawyn:
  log_level: error
  metrics_host: metrics.ulawyn.lumiclabs.internal
  pin: 0564
  pool_size: 32

## Authentication

The Glyphsift encoding-detection service sits behind the internal Charlock gateway. All detection requests on uploaded text files require the service key in the `X-Charlock-Key` header; unauthenticated calls return 401 immediately. On-call: if detection starts failing farm-wide, check key expiry first before restarting workers. Rotation happens monthly; stale keys are the most common incident cause. Do not reuse this key outside the gateway. The active key is below.

app token of badug-tahaf = qvz11-nP5FBNr8qnh

Q2 Planning Note — Heads of Department, Caldreth Manufacturing

As flagged at the April review, the marketing budget will be reduced by 18% for the remainder of the fiscal year. Trade-show participation in Northvale and Essmere is cancelled; digital campaigns for the Torvik line continue at reduced spend. Department heads should submit revised allocations to Priya by Friday. Headcount is unaffected. The savings will be redirected per the plan summarized below.

board note of fafog-yahap: Project Rusdor slips by a full year because of the audit delay.

# Dependency pinning policy for the Harrowgate build.
# All third-party packages are pinned to exact versions; ranges are
# forbidden outside the sandbox manifest. The release manager bumps
# pins only during the quiet window, one ecosystem at a time, with a
# full regression pass before tagging. Exceptions need a written
# waiver. The constant below records the verified snapshot, traceable
# via the token that follows.

session token of bawep-yadup = htk21_528abd376e3c5a4ec24a1